The Israel Nano therapy market is experiencing significant growth driven by advancements in nanotechnology and a strong focus on research and development in the healthcare sector. Nano therapy offers targeted drug delivery, imaging, and diagnostic solutions with enhanced efficacy and reduced side effects compared to traditional therapies. The market is witnessing increasing investments from both government and private sector players, fostering innovation and adoption of nano therapy solutions across various medical fields such as oncology, neurology, and cardiology. Key market players are expanding their product portfolios and collaborations to capitalize on the growing demand for personalized and precision medicine in Israel. Regulatory support and favorable funding opportunities further contribute to the expanding Nano therapy market in Israel.

Several challenges are faced in the Israel Nano therapy market, including regulatory hurdles due to the complex nature of nanomedicine, limited funding for research and development, and the need for specialized expertise in both nanotechnology and healthcare. Additionally, there is a lack of standardization in manufacturing processes and quality control for nano-based therapies, leading to concerns about safety and efficacy. Market acceptance and adoption of nano therapies also pose challenges, as healthcare providers and patients may be hesitant to embrace relatively new and advanced treatment options. Overall, navigating these challenges requires collaboration between industry stakeholders, government bodies, and research institutions to address regulatory, financial, and technological barriers in order to drive innovation and growth in the Israel Nano therapy market.

The Israeli government has been supportive of the nano therapy market through various policies and initiatives. The government has established the Israel Innovation Authority, which provides funding and support for research and development in the field of nanotechnology and healthcare. Additionally, Israel offers tax incentives and grants to companies engaged in developing nano therapy solutions. The government has also invested in creating collaborative platforms and clusters to facilitate knowledge sharing and innovation in the sector. Overall, the government`s policies aim to promote the growth of the Israeli nano therapy market by fostering a conducive environment for research, development, and commercialization of innovative therapies.
